It's probably quite realistic, too. If you buy a mid range PC processor, it
might cost you 500 quarks. If you buy one half as quick, ie a low range one,
it'll probably only cost you 100 quarks. If you buy one 50% faster, ie near
the top of the range, it'll probably cost you 1000 quarks. A top of the
range model, twice as fast as the mid range one, will set you back something
like 2000 quarks! It's not linear.
